What is an HS code?

  • An internationally accepted system of names and numbers used to classify traded products
  • Maintained by the World Trade Organization, these codes are standardized across all countries in the WTO at 6 digits. Past digits, it becomes country-specific
  • Find the average duty rates by HS code and country here: http://tariffdata.wto.org/ReportersAndProducts.aspx

Why do I need HS codes?

  • Determines the tariff and duty rates of the traded products
  • Identifies products that are imported or exported through a country’s borders
  • Classifies & categorizes products in a worldwide system used for customs clearance purposes

What if I don't have my HS codes?

  • Many merchants don’t realize they do have them – on the import documents!
  • Your manufacturer or carriers may have them
  • You can search online for informational purposes using UK Govt website for an idea of possible ones: https://www.trade-tariff.service.gov.uk/sections

HS code strategy

When you choose the Pricing Strategy to apply, consider the fee calculation that takes into account the 6-digit level to return the value based on the configuration: average, maximum, or minimum.

  • MINIMUM - The system will return the minimum duty rate found in the tariffs based on the number of HS digits the caller provides in the request.
  • MAXIMUM - The system will return the maximum duty rate found in the tariffs based on the number of HS digits the callers provide in the request.
  • AVERAGE - The system will return the average duty rate found in the tariffs based on the number of HS digits the caller provides in the request.
